In the competitive landscape of social media apps, maintaining high user engagement is crucial for the success of any TikTok clone app. With users bombarded by countless options, it’s essential to adopt effective strategies that captivate and retain your audience. This comprehensive guide will explore proven techniques to boost user engagement and ensure your TikTok clone app stands out in a crowded market.
1. Understand Your Target Audience
Before implementing any engagement strategies, it’s vital to have a deep understanding of your target audience. Conduct thorough research to identify their preferences, interests, and behaviors. Analyze demographic data, user feedback, and industry trends to tailor your app’s features and content to meet their needs. By aligning your app’s offerings with user expectations, you can create a more engaging experience.
2. Create a User-Friendly Interface
A well-designed user interface (UI) is the cornerstone of user engagement. Your TikTok clone app should offer an intuitive and seamless experience, making it easy for users to navigate and interact with the platform. Focus on:
- Simple Navigation: Ensure that key features like the feed, profile, and settings are easily accessible.
- Responsive Design: Optimize your app for various devices and screen sizes to provide a consistent experience.
- Appealing Visuals: Use high-quality graphics and a clean layout to create a visually appealing environment.
3. Incorporate Engaging Content Features
Content is the heart of any social media app. To keep users engaged, provide features that enhance content creation and consumption:
- Advanced Editing Tools: Offer a range of video editing options, including filters, effects, and transitions, to help users create high-quality content.
- Music and Sound Effects: Integrate a diverse library of music and sound effects to add variety and creativity to user videos.
- Interactive Elements: Include features like polls, quizzes, and challenges to encourage user interaction and participation.
4. Leverage Personalization
Personalization enhances user engagement by delivering relevant content tailored to individual preferences. Implement these strategies:
- Algorithmic Recommendations: Use machine learning algorithms to analyze user behavior and suggest content that matches their interests.
- Customizable Feeds: Allow users to curate their feeds based on categories, hashtags, or user preferences.
- Personalized Notifications: Send notifications about new content, trends, or updates that align with users’ interests.
5. Foster a Strong Community
Building a sense of community within your app can significantly boost user engagement. Encourage interaction and collaboration through:
- User-Generated Challenges: Create and promote challenges that encourage users to participate and showcase their creativity.
- Community Building Features: Implement features like groups, forums, or live chat to facilitate communication and interaction among users.
- In-App Contests and Giveaways: Organize contests and giveaways to incentivize participation and reward active users.
6. Implement Gamification
Gamification techniques can make your app more engaging and fun. Incorporate elements like:
- Achievements and Badges: Reward users with badges and achievements for milestones such as video views, likes, or content creation.
- Leaderboards: Display leaderboards to highlight top content creators and active users, fostering a sense of competition and motivation.
- Progress Tracking: Allow users to track their progress and achievements, encouraging them to stay active and engaged.
7. Optimize Onboarding Experience
The onboarding process sets the tone for users’ experience with your app. Ensure that new users have a smooth and engaging introduction by:
- Guided Tours: Provide a brief tutorial or guided tour to familiarize users with the app’s features and functionality.
- Easy Sign-Up: Simplify the registration process with options for social media logins or quick sign-ups.
- Personalized Onboarding: Customize the onboarding experience based on user preferences and interests to make it more relevant.
8. Enhance Content Discoverability
To keep users engaged, make it easy for them to discover new and relevant content:
- Trending Topics and Hashtags: Highlight trending topics and hashtags to keep users informed about popular content and trends.
- Content Curation: Use algorithms to curate content based on user preferences, ensuring that users see relevant and engaging videos.
- Search Functionality: Implement a robust search feature that allows users to find content, creators, or topics of interest quickly.
9. Encourage Social Sharing
Facilitating social sharing can drive user engagement and attract new users to your app. Implement features that make it easy for users to share content on other social media platforms:
- Share Buttons: Include share buttons that allow users to post their favorite videos or content to external platforms.
- Social Media Integration: Integrate with popular social media networks to enable seamless sharing and cross-promotion.
- Referral Programs: Create referral programs that reward users for inviting friends to join the app.
10. Monitor and Analyze User Feedback
Regularly monitoring user feedback and analyzing engagement metrics is crucial for understanding what works and what doesn’t. Use this data to make informed decisions and continuously improve your app:
- User Surveys: Conduct surveys to gather feedback on user experience, feature preferences, and areas for improvement.
- Analytics Tools: Utilize analytics tools to track key metrics such as user retention, session duration, and content interaction.
- A/B Testing: Implement A/B testing to evaluate the effectiveness of new features or changes and refine your app based on results.
11. Regularly Update and Innovate
Keeping your app fresh and exciting is essential for maintaining user engagement. Regularly update your app with new features, content, and improvements:
- Feature Updates: Introduce new features and enhancements based on user feedback and industry trends.
- Seasonal Content: Create seasonal or themed content to keep users engaged and interested throughout the year.
- Bug Fixes and Performance Improvements: Regularly address bugs and performance issues to ensure a smooth user experience.
12. Build Strategic Partnerships
Collaborating with influencers, brands, and other apps can boost your app’s visibility and engagement. Consider these partnership strategies:
- Influencer Collaborations: Partner with influencers and content creators to promote your app and reach a broader audience.
- Brand Partnerships: Collaborate with brands to create sponsored content or exclusive offers for users.
- Cross-Promotions: Explore cross-promotion opportunities with other apps or platforms to attract new users.
Conclusion
Increasing user engagement in your TikTok clone app requires a multifaceted approach that combines understanding your audience, optimizing the user experience, and continuously innovating. By implementing these strategies, you can create a compelling and engaging app that captures users’ attention, fosters community, and drives long-term success. Focus on delivering value, enhancing user experience, and staying attuned to trends and feedback to maintain a competitive edge in the dynamic social media landscape.